Jasper County, Indiana

Founded in 1838 and named for Sgt. Jasper, Revolutionary War scout

County Seat: Rensselaer

Largest City: Rensselaer (2021 population: 6,130)

Population per Square Mile: 59.13

Square Miles: 559.60
